Sources: Republican Jack Ciattarelli To Concede New Jersey's Governor's Race

TRENTON, N.J. (CBSNewYork) -- Sources say Jack Ciattarelli, the Republican nominee for New Jersey governor, is expected to concede to Phil Murphy.

Ciattarelli will address his supporters at a news conference in his hometown of Raritan on Friday afternoon.

In a video message right after the election, Ciattarelli refused to acknowledge Murphy's narrow victory until all mail-in and provisional ballots were counted.
